Abstract
A -knot is an embedding of a -sphere into the -sphere. Similar to the case of embedding circles into the -sphere, this allows the -sphere to be knotted. In this short paper, we present an algorithm to generate triangulations of the exteriors of -knots obtained by spinning -knots. We give an implementation of the algorithm in \emph{Regina} and present triangulations of exteriors obtained from all -knots with up to eight crossings.
